Each application would require the applicant's employment agreement, proof your business is actively and lawfully operating, letter of support from the accountant of the company and a current lease agreement. The applicant is thus required to point out either an audited record and profit & loss statement for the last two financial years or business tax returns, and associated assessment notices for the previous financial year. Other evidence may include proof you've got a real need for a paid employee, detailed organization structure chart, detailed position description including specified tasks and duties of the position. For business immigration Australia, firstly, the employer must apply for approval as a typical business sponsor and nominate the position(s) to be undertaken in Australia by the overseas worker. Meaning that the sponsor has got to show that they're operating a lawful, reputable business in Australia, the sponsorship is of benefit to Australia, which they're going to be the direct employer of the applicant.
To nominate an edge there must be a requirement for a paid overseas employee during a full-time position and therefore the position must get on the list of approved occupations. This list is sort of broad and includes tradespeople and professionals. The employer has got to specify the type of tasks the worker will get to perform and what experience and skills are required. The employer must also show that they're going to pay the worker the minimum salary specified by the government for migration purposes. They even have to simply accept certain obligations towards the worker, including providing acceptable working conditions.
The employee residing in another nation then applies for an Australia business visa to fill the nominated position. The worker must show that they possess the training, qualifications and knowledge which are necessary to fill the position. The worker will get to produce their qualifications and employment references and should be required to undergo a skill assessment.
You can sponsor overseas employees on a short-lived term from 3 months to 4 years or for permanent residency. Although the wants for a permanent visa are very similar, they're more stringent than for the temporary visa. For instance, for a permanent visa, the applicant must be under 45 years old. This is often not necessary if you apply for a short-lived Australia business visa.
